Market Overview
The Global Dairy Testing Market is witnessing robust expansion driven by heightened consumer demand for safe, high-quality dairy products and stringent food safety regulations worldwide. Dairy testing encompasses a broad array of analytical services—ranging from microbiological assays and chemical residue analysis to nutritional profiling and authenticity verification—to ensure compliance with standards such as the Codex Alimentarius, FDA, and EU regulations. Rising concerns over adulteration, antibiotic residues, mycotoxins, and pathogens in milk and dairy derivatives have propelled investments in advanced testing methods, including PCR, ELISA, chromatography, and spectroscopy. As the global dairy supply chain grows more complex—spanning smallholder farms, large-scale cooperatives, and industrial processors—comprehensive testing solutions are critical for brand protection, consumer confidence, and international trade.
Meaning
Dairy testing refers to the systematic evaluation of milk and dairy products to detect contaminants, verify composition, and assess nutritional and functional attributes. Core testing categories include microbiological analysis (to identify pathogens like L. monocytogenes, Salmonella, and E. coli), chemical residue screening (for antibiotics, hormones, and pesticides), proximate analysis (fat, protein, lactose, moisture), adulteration detection (water addition, foreign proteins), and allergen quantification. By applying validated laboratory techniques and rapid in-field testing kits, stakeholders—from farmers to food regulators—can monitor product safety and quality at each stage of the value chain.

Market Drivers
-
Stringent Regulations: Government mandates—such as the EU’s Rapid Alert System for Food and Feed (RASFF) and the US Pasteurized Milk Ordinance—require comprehensive dairy testing across microbiology, chemistry, and allergens.
-
Consumer Awareness: Heightened concern over antibiotic residues, GM feed, and adulteration is prompting dairy brands to validate “clean label” claims through third-party testing.
-
Global Trade Expansion: Exports of dairy commodities (e.g., cheese, butter, powdered milk) necessitate compliance with diverse standards, driving testing at multiple checkpoints.
-
Technological Advancements: Innovations like lab-on-a-chip, next-generation sequencing for pathogen typing, and hyperspectral imaging are enhancing detection speed and accuracy.
-
Supply Chain Traceability: Blockchain pilots in dairy are integrating test-result data to enable end-to-end product verification, further fueling testing demand.
Market Restraints
-
High Testing Costs: Comprehensive laboratory analyses, particularly for multi-residue and mycotoxin panels, can be cost-prohibitive for smallholders.
-
Infrastructure Gaps: Limited laboratory capacity and trained personnel in emerging regions hinder widespread adoption of advanced testing methods.
-
Standardization Challenges: Variation in regional testing protocols complicates result comparability and can delay approval for international shipments.
-
Sample Logistics: Maintaining cold-chain integrity during sample transport remains a challenge in remote dairy-producing areas.
-
Data Management: Integrating test data from disparate sources into a unified quality-management system requires significant IT investment.

Regional Analysis
-
North America: Mature market dominated by third-party labs offering ISO 17025–accredited services; high adoption of advanced techniques such as LC-MS/MS for multi-residue screening.
-
Europe: Stringent EU labeling and maximum residue limits (MRLs) drive comprehensive testing; growing preference for near-infrared (NIR) for rapid compositional analysis.
-
Asia Pacific: Fastest-growing region, led by China and India, where government modernization projects are expanding laboratory networks and enforcing stricter dairy standards.
-
Latin America: Brazil and Argentina are investing in dairy-sector traceability initiatives, integrating regional labs into export-compliance supply chains.
-
Middle East & Africa: Penetration remains modest but rising, with GCC nations funding modernization of dairy safety labs and East African cooperatives piloting mobile testing vans.
